Introduction:
The goal of this course is to instruct teachers in new and innovative ways to use technology to effectively teach concepts in precalculus, statistics and calculus while developing a teacher leader community to support local, ongoing professional development needs. The primary focus of the course is the exploration of functions as well as the mathematics of variability and change using TI calculators, data collection devices, and computer technology as tools for teaching and learning. Participants will learn new teaching strategies and will have opportunities for hands-on experiences with a variety of precalculus, statistics and calculus activities. This course is designed for new or experienced users of the TI-84 Plus.
